Digital copy of Exhibit AF49: Operation Rectangle Final Report prepared by Detective Inspector Alison Fossey, States of Jersey Police. [Some details redacted]. Used in relation to Alison Fossey's first Witness Statement to the Inquiry, dated 3 December 2015, see ZC/D/AW4/B2/3/WS000687. Date 1 September 2010 - 30 September 2010
Scope and Content Provides details relating to Introduction - a brief history of child care in Jersey, Events leading up to Operation Rectangle, Significant phases and events, Phase one, Phase two, Phase three, Phase four, Terms of reference and the investigative strategy, Forensic strategy, Witness liason strategy, and Media strategy. Provides details relating to Case preparation and disclosure, and Major incident room - resourcing and logistics. Includes Timeline of arrests and interviews during Operation Rectangle, naming Gordon Wateridge, Claude Donnelly, Michael Aubin, Mario Lundy, Fay Campbell, Morag Jordan, Anthony Jordan, Kevin Noel, Leonard Vandenborn, Alan Maguire, Jane Maguire, employees of Children's Services, employees of Haut de la Garenne, employees of La Préférence Children's Home, employees of Les Chênes Residential School, houseparents of a family group home, individuals, and a politician.
